My Birmingham based client is looking for a Production Administration to help administer and co-ordinate the activity of the production process to ensure optimal efficiency and output in order to meet customers delivery requirements.Benefits:

  • Salary up to £30,00 Dependent on experience
  • Private Medical Scheme after 2 years' service.
  • Quarterly Social Events
  • 28 Days Holiday inc 8 x Bank Holidays
  • Mon-Thurs - 8am-5pm Fri - 8am - 2pm

Duties and responsibilities:

  • Creating & Maintaining Stock Control Systems and Procedures.
  • Understanding Product Bills of Materials.
  • Accurately enter data into manufacturing databases and systems, including production schedules, inventory records, and quality control documentation.
  • Maintain comprehensive and up-to-date records of manufacturing activities, ensuring data integrity and accessibility for reporting and analysis.
  • Assist in coordinating production schedules, including material procurement and equipment availability.
  • Communicate with production teams to ensure timely completion of orders and adherence to production targets.
  • Assist in coordinating production schedules, including material procurement, equipment availability, and workforce allocation.
  • Communicate with production teams to ensure timely completion of orders and adherence to production targets.

Skills and experience:

  • Fast learner with the ability to understand new process quickly and accurately.
  • Keen attention to detail.
  • Experience operating in a manufacturing/ assembly environment.
  • Ability to work efficiently to deadlines.
  • Ability to self-manage daily workload / tasks.
  • MS Excel - using formulas to manipulate data.
  • Proficient in MS Office Packages
